25 |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Avelina Martinez made an unannounced visit to conduct an annual inspection on 08/24/2021 at 10:20 AM. LPA met with Carlomagno Esquillo and stated the purpose of today’s visit. LPA inspected the physical plant including but not limited to the kitchen, dining room, resident bedrooms; resident bathrooms, laundry room, activity room of the facility to ensure compliance with Title 22 regulations.
Administrator holds expired certificate # 6030833740 and it expired on 06/04/2020. Recertification documentation was submitted to CCLD on 04/05/2021, and administrator certification is pending. The facility is licensed for six non-ambulatory and five ambulatory residents. There are currently 6 residents who reside at this facility.
The LPA toured the facility with Carlomagno Esquillo on 08/24/2021 at :10:30 AM.
During this annual visit, LPA Martinez observed the cleaning progress of this facility. The licensee is currently painting the outside of the facility and removing miscellaneous items from the outside. In addition, the common bathrooms and bedroom are in the process of being painted. The cleaning of the resident bedrooms and common areas is being done. The facility has a LIC 808 mitigation plan and has Covid-19 posting in the facility.
Employee and resident files have been updated and contain the required documents. LPA Martinez reviewed 3 employee files and 3 resident files. LPA Martinez reviewed 3 resident medication files, which were up to date. Fire Department conducted a fire inspection 08/06/2021. The smoke and carbon detectors are in good repair. The facility staff will continue with the following: On going cleaning of the interior and exterior of the facility. Facility staff will continue to conduct record reviews of employee and resident files. Meal Preparation waiver has been submitted to the Department. Moreover, the facility kitchen has perishable and non-perishable foods. The kitchen is clean. As a result of the visit, there were no deficiencies cited. An exit interview was conducted and a report given at the end of the visit.
